The Four Cs: Selecting Your Perfect Diamond
Understanding the Four Cs—carat weight, cut, color, and clarity—is fundamental to selecting the right diamond. These criteria directly impact both the beauty and value of your jewelry in Nyack, NY. Let’s explore each component in detail.
Carat Weight and Size
Carat weight measures the diamond’s mass, with each carat equaling 200 milligrams. Contrary to popular belief, more carats don’t always mean a more beautiful ring. The visual difference between a 1-carat and 1.5-carat diamond is subtle, yet the price difference can be significant. Cut Quality and Brilliance
The cut of a diamond determines its sparkle and light reflection. A well-cut diamond will demonstrate superior brilliance, even if the carat weight is modest. Cut grades range from Ideal to Poor, with Excellent and Very Good cuts offering the best balance between beauty and value. Color Grades and Appearance
Diamond color is graded on a scale from D (colorless) to Z (light color). Most people cannot discern the difference between D-colored and H-colored diamonds without professional equipment. Clarity refers to the presence or absence of inclusions within the diamond. The clarity scale ranges from FL (Flawless) to I3 (Included). Most diamonds contain tiny inclusions that don’t affect their beauty or structural integrity. Gold: Classic and Versatile
Gold remains the most popular choice for engagement rings. Available in white, yellow, and rose varieties, gold offers versatility to match any style preference. White gold provides a contemporary look similar to platinum but at a lower price point. Yellow gold exudes classic warmth and elegance, while rose gold has experienced a renaissance among modern couples seeking romantic sophistication.
Gold purity is measured in karats, with 14K and 18K being the most common for engagement rings. 14K gold contains 58.3% pure gold and offers excellent durability for daily wear. 18K gold, containing 75% pure gold, provides richer color but is slightly softer. Maintenance and Long-Term Care
Your engagement ring will become one of your most cherished possessions, worn daily for decades. Proper maintenance ensures it remains as beautiful as the day you received it. Understanding care requirements helps protect your investment and preserve its value and appearance.
Regular Cleaning and Inspection
Regular cleaning keeps your ring sparkling and helps you notice any potential issues early. Daily cleaning with warm soapy water and a soft brush removes oils, lotions, and dirt that can dull your diamond’s brilliance. Protecting Your Investment
Remove your engagement ring during activities that could damage it. Intense exercise, gardening, swimming, and household chores expose your ring to unnecessary stress and chemicals. Even minor impacts can loosen a stone or crack a setting. Professional jewelers offering repair services recommend removing your ring during these activities.
Insurance is essential for protecting your ring’s monetary value. Homeowner’s or renter’s insurance typically doesn’t adequately cover jewelry, so specialized jewelry insurance is recommended. The cost is minimal relative to your ring’s value, and coverage includes loss, theft, and damage.
Professional resizing and adjustments ensure your ring remains comfortable as your hand changes over time. Pregnancy, weight fluctuations, and aging all affect ring fit. Jewelers specializing in repairs can adjust your ring to maintain comfort without compromising its integrity.
